Engine Coolant Temperature
Sender / Switch

a.

Engine Coolant Temperature Sender Removal

1. Park the machine on a firm, level surface, level the

machine, fully retract the boom, lower the boom,
place the transmission control lever in
(N) NEUTRAL, engage the park brake and shut the
engine OFF.

2. Place a Do Not Operate Tag on both the ignition key

switch and the steering wheel, stating that the
machine should not be operated.

3. Open the engine cover. Allow the system fluids to

cool.

4. Disconnect the battery negative (-) cable from the

battery negative (-) terminal. Unplug the engine
coolant temperature sender /switch connector from
the wiring harness connector.

5. Unplug the engine coolant temperature sender

connector from the wiring harness connector.

6. The engine coolant temperature sender (1) is

threaded into the engine block. Remove the sender.

b. Engine Coolant Temperature Sender / Switch

Inspection and Replacement

Inspect the sender/switch and the wiring harness
connector terminals for continuity. Replace a defective or
faulty sender with a new part.

c. Engine Coolant Temperature Sender Installation

and Testing

1. Thread the engine coolant temperature sender into

the engine block snugly, then connect the sender
connector to the wiring harness connector.

2. Connect the battery negative (-) cable to the battery

negative (-) terminal.

3. Check for proper coolant level.

4. Start the engine, allow it to reach operating

temperature and observe the operator’s instrument
cluster for warning indication. If the sender is not
defective, the problem could be elsewhere; possibly
in a shorted wire, improper-running engine, improper
or low coolant, obstructed or faulty radiator, coolant
pump, loose fan belt, defective instrument display,
etc.

5. Close and secure the engine cover.

Fuel Level Sender

a. Fuel Level Indicator Testing

1. The fuel level sender wiring harness leads can be

accessed from the top of the fuel tank. Disconnect
the fuel level sender wiring harness leads. With the
help of an assistant, touch both harness leads
together.

2. From the operator’s cab, have the assistant turn the

ignition key switch to the RUN position. DO NOT
start the engine. Observe the fuel level indicator
needle on the operator’s instrument cluster. The
reading must be at the FULL mark.

3. Turn the ignition key switch to the OFF position. The

fuel level indicator needle should return to the
EMPTY position.
